The Best Sustainable Shoes and Boots for Fall From the Ethos Founders

Share

Step into comfort and style with these sustainable and chic shoes and boots for fall.

It’s been a long year inside, hasn’t it? For most of us, that’s meant shoeless meetings, shoeless Zoom happy hours, and shoeless couch-bound date nights. With kids heading back to in-person school (yay!), along with offices and businesses opening back up, there’s no better time to slip into a new pair of shoes and step into the sustainable future at the same time. These boots and shoes are all at the top of our lists, and for good reason. Made with sustainable materials, vegan leather, and attention to detail, they’re sure to be in heavy rotation. Jackie’s Picks

Aera New York, Giselle—Naturl Python Effect

The best part about the fall season? It’s the boots. Even when living in warmer climates of Miami and Dubai, by the time October hits, I’m pulling out boots to pair with mini skirts and shorts. I already have my eyes on a few that I’ll be snagging in the next few weeks so I’ll be ready to go (and won’t have to worry about my popular size 8.5 selling out). On the top of my list are these grey python effect knee boots from vegan brand Aera. The neutral grey is perfect to pair with multiple outfits all season long. Aera New York makes its shoes from vegan and upcycled materials. Made in a factory powered by solar electricity and lowered Co2 emissions, these luxury boots are made with water-based resins.

Collection & Co, Elia Black Vegan Leather Cross Over Detailed Sandal

If you like to stretch out sandal season just a bit longer like I do, then these vegan leather sandals are sure to fit right into your early fall wardrobe. The black color and studs will edge up any wardrobe perfectly for the cooler temperatures. Collection & Co’s shoes are made from a variety of materials including pineapple leaf fabrics, recycled plastic, and materials leftover from previous collections. With efforts to manufacture responsibly, the collections are made in small quantities out of the small factory in Greece.

Pīferi Mirage 100

For the not-so-practical, I am a sucker for over-the-knee boots. I love that I can wear them with jeans and instantly elevate my outfit, or really go to the nines and wear them with a black cocktail dress. There isn’t much I cannot accomplish with these babies! Pifere is an incredible London-based brand that is dedicated to social and sustainable responsibility. The company uses fair-trade factories in Italy and the BIOVEG-certified Bio Vegan App is composed of 48% bio polyols derived from nonfood and GMO-free field corn, and the soles are made with 100% pure cellulose.

Louis Vuitton Charlie Sneaker

Forget the handbag: luxury fashion label Louis Vuitton is launching its first unisex shoe this fall. And it’s the brand’s most sustainable sneaker to date. According to the French label, the new sneaker is made from 90 percent recycled or bio-sourced materials and is part of the brand’s shift to eco-conscious materials and practices. Stella McCartney Emilie Teddy Boots, Black

Two words: Stella McCartney. Has anyone done more for sustainable fashion? And style in general, for that matter? While these Emilie Teddy boots are certainly winter-ready, they’re just too cute to not wear them the second the weather cools. Made with alter mat vegan fleece, sustainable wood, and recycled polyester, the platform wedge heels take eco footwear to new heights—literally.

Balluta Omega Chelsea Boot

These handcrafted boots from Ballūta are made in Portugal with PVC-free patent vegan leather and sustainable, chromium-free microfiber, viscose, and cellulose lining. Designed to make any outfit instantly sensational, you’ll want to wear these all season long. With a brand DNA that’s cruelty-free and quality-committed, you’re going to love this company as much as you love the boots!
